LG G Vista VS880 rumored to go on sale via Verizon this Friday

While a lot of information has been leaked about the LG G Vista VS880 phablet, its release date has been a mystery so far. Well, thanks to a leakster, we now have a possible launch date which is July 18, this Friday, albeit the price is still a mystery.

The LG G Vista VS880 has been making headlines ever since @evleaks revealed its existence. We’ve seen the device in press images and even sized up against the G3 flagship. And recently, specs of the device were revealed by the same leakster who’s also the source of the launch information.

Where looks are concerned, the upcoming device is almost identical to the current flagship. Apart from the placement of a few components, the only difference is in the screen size. If you look carefully at the above image, the phone on the right has a slightly broader panel.

This display is said to be 5.7 inches wide and it won’t offer 1080p resolution, but 720p HD visuals. Performance-wise, the phone has nothing to brag about, but it does come with a large 3200mAh battery. And for its size, it’s pretty lightweight at 168 grams.

Here’s a roundup of the LG G Vista VS880 specs:

– OS: Android 4.4 KitKat
– Display: 5.7-inch HD IPS LCD
– Processor: 1.2GHz quad core Snapdragon 400
– Camera: 8MP rear, 1.3MP front
– Memory: 8GB storage, 1.5GB RAM
– Battery: 3200mAh

Seeing as the LG G Vista VS880 is a mid-range device, it’s most likely to carry an affordable subsidized price on Verizon, probably between $99 and $149. However, it does come with the same flagship design, so its full retail amount could sting.
